本發明係有關於一種銑刀之改良,尤指一種銑削內槽、內螺紋之捨棄式環槽銑刀。 The invention relates to an improvement of a milling cutter, in particular to a discarding annular groove milling cutter for milling an inner groove and an internal thread.
請參閱第15、16圖所示,一般習用之環槽銑刀,主要係應用於環槽70之銑削加工,作為各式扣環之使用,該環槽銑刀主要包含一刀桿40,該刀桿40之端面鎖固一捨棄式環槽刀片50,該捨棄式環槽刀片50係為鎢鋼材質並以粉末冶金沖壓成型,該捨棄式環槽刀片50之一端設有凸塊51,其與刀桿40端面之凹槽41對應,藉由螺絲60組合,該捨棄式環槽刀片50之一側設一刀刃52,藉由該刀刃52銑削尺寸較小之環槽70。 Referring to Figures 15 and 16, the conventional ring groove milling cutter is mainly used for the milling of the ring groove 70. As a variety of buckles, the ring groove milling cutter mainly comprises a cutter bar 40, the cutter The end face of the rod 40 locks a retractable ring groove blade 50, which is made of tungsten steel and is formed by powder metallurgy, and one end of the retractable ring groove blade 50 is provided with a bump 51, which is Corresponding to the groove 41 of the end face of the arbor 40, a blade 52 is disposed on one side of the disposable ring groove blade 50 by the combination of the screws 60, and the ring groove 70 having a smaller size is milled by the blade 52.
請參閱第17、18圖所示,尺寸較大之環槽,係藉由多刃式之環槽銑刀銑削,該捨棄式環槽刀片80之一端設有端軸81,該捨棄式環槽刀片80之一側設有至少一個以上之勒體82,該勒體82之側面延伸有一凸塊83,該勒體82之末端設有刀刃84,該捨棄式環槽刀片80之端軸81及勒體82側面延之凸塊83分別與刀桿90端面之圓柱孔91及凹槽92對應,藉由螺絲60鎖固;藉由該多刃式之環槽銑刀得以銑削尺寸較大之環槽70。 Referring to Figures 17 and 18, the larger-sized ring groove is milled by a multi-blade ring groove cutter, and one end of the disposable ring groove blade 80 is provided with an end shaft 81, which is a retractable ring groove. One side of the blade 80 is provided with at least one or more of the body 82. The side of the body 82 extends with a protrusion 83. The end of the body 82 is provided with a blade 84, and the end shaft 81 of the discarded ring groove blade 80 and The protrusions 83 extending from the side of the body 82 respectively correspond to the cylindrical holes 91 and the grooves 92 of the end surface of the cutter bar 90, and are locked by screws 60. The multi-blade ring groove milling cutter can be used to mill a larger ring. Slot 70.
由前述之說明,不論是單刃式或是多刃式之環槽銑刀,其捨棄式環槽刀片50、80係由鎢系粉末冶金加壓成型,非刀刃之部位,佔用環槽刀片大部分之體積,銑削之尺寸越大,體積相對增加,相對浪費過多之 材料於非銑削之部位,因此造成該捨棄式環槽銑刀價格高昂及經濟效益差等缺點。 From the foregoing description, whether it is a single-blade or multi-blade ring groove milling cutter, the discarded ring groove inserts 50 and 80 are formed by tungsten powder metallurgy pressure molding, and the non-blade part occupies a large ring groove blade. Part of the volume, the larger the size of the milling, the relative increase in volume, relatively wasteful The material is not in the milling part, thus causing the disadvantages of the high cost and poor economic efficiency of the disposable ring groove milling cutter.
習知捨棄式環槽銑刀,由於結構特殊之設計,導致鎢系粉末冶金加壓成型之捨棄式環槽刀片,其非刀刃部位占用大部分體積,浪費過多之材料,致捨棄式環槽銑刀價格高昂。 Due to the special structure design, the discarded ring groove milling cutter has a special structure, which leads to the discarded ring groove insert of tungsten powder metallurgy pressure forming. The non-blade part occupies most of the volume, wastes too much material, and the abandoned ring groove milling The price of the knife is high.
本發明為一種捨棄式環槽銑刀,包含一刀桿,該刀桿末端由一螺絲鎖固一捨棄式環槽刀片,該刀桿末端設有一刀槽座,該刀槽座得供一捨棄式環槽刀片容置入,該刀槽座之一隅設一圓弧孔,該圓弧孔之一側設一螺孔,該螺孔其供螺絲頭容置之錐形孔係與該圓弧孔之部位相互重疊過切;該捨棄式環槽刀片,包含一板狀之本體,該本體之一側延伸設一刀刃,該本體頂面之一側邊設有一定位栓,該定位栓之一側設一讓槽,該讓槽之末端設一斜推面。 The invention relates to a disposable ring groove milling cutter, comprising a cutter rod, the cutter rod end is locked by a screw and a discarded ring groove blade, and the cutter rod end is provided with a cutter seat, the cutter seat seat is provided for a discarding type The ring groove insert is accommodated, and one of the slot seats is provided with a circular arc hole, and one of the circular arc holes is provided with a screw hole, and the screw hole is provided with a tapered hole and a circular hole for receiving the screw head The part of the top surface of the body is provided with a cutting edge, and one side of the positioning plug is provided on one side of the top surface of the body. A slot is provided, and the end of the slot is provided with a tilting surface.
本發明藉由螺絲之螺絲頭得以推頂捨棄式環槽刀片之斜推面以及搭配螺紋之鎖固,使得該捨棄式環槽刀片與刀槽座在3個軸向完全受到限制與固定,且該捨棄式環槽刀片係由高硬度材料製成,其體積小不會隨著銑刀之大小而改變,具降低成本低之功效,藉由刀盤之結構設計改變銑削之尺寸,不會有刀具材料浪費之情形。 The invention is capable of pushing the inclined surface of the retractable ring groove blade and the locking with the thread by the screw head of the screw, so that the discarded ring groove blade and the knife seat are completely restricted and fixed in three axial directions, and The disposable ring groove blade is made of high-hardness material, and its small size does not change with the size of the milling cutter. It has the effect of reducing cost and low cost. The size of the milling is changed by the structural design of the cutter head. The waste of tool materials.

請參閱第1~3圖所示,本發明捨棄式環槽銑刀,包含一刀桿10,該刀桿10末端由一螺絲30鎖固一捨棄式環槽刀片20,其中:該刀桿10,於末端設有一刀槽座11,該刀槽座11得供一捨棄式環槽刀片20容置入,該刀槽座11之一隅設一呈半圓形狀之圓弧孔111,該圓弧孔111之一側設一螺孔12,該螺孔12其供螺絲頭31容置之錐形孔121係與該圓弧孔111之部位相互重疊過切。 Referring to FIGS. 1~3, the disposable ring groove milling cutter of the present invention comprises a cutter bar 10, and the end of the cutter bar 10 is locked by a screw 30 to a retractable ring groove cutter 20, wherein: the cutter bar 10, A slotted seat 11 is disposed at the end, and the slotted seat 11 is received by a discarding annular slotted blade 20, and one of the slotted seats 11 defines a circular arc hole 111 having a semicircular shape. The circular arc hole 111 One of the screw holes 12 is provided on the side of the screw hole 12, and the tapered hole 121 for receiving the screw head 31 and the portion of the circular arc hole 111 overlap each other.
該捨棄式環槽刀片20,包含一板狀之本體21,該本體21之一側延伸設一刀刃22,該本體21頂面之一側邊設有一半圓形狀之定位栓23, 該定位栓23之一側邊設一讓槽241,該讓槽241之末端設一斜推面242。 The retractable annular grooved blade 20 includes a plate-shaped body 21, and a blade edge 22 is extended on one side of the body 21. One side of the top surface of the body 21 is provided with a semicircular shape positioning pin 23. One side of the positioning pin 23 is provided with a slot 241, and an end of the slot 241 is provided with a tilting surface 242.
請參閱第1、4、5圖所示,本發明之捨棄式環槽刀片20置入 該刀桿10末端之刀槽座11內,藉由螺絲30螺入螺孔12時,該螺絲頭31將推頂捨棄式環槽刀片20之斜推面242,由該螺絲頭31與斜推面242之接觸點分析該捨棄式環槽刀片20承受朝下(-Z)、朝右(X)及前(Y)方向之推力,朝下(-Z)之推力使得該捨棄式環槽刀片20與刀槽座11之底面緊密接觸,而該朝右(X)之推力使得該捨棄式環槽刀片20之定位栓23與刀槽座11之圓弧孔111緊密接觸,而該朝前(Y)之推力使得該捨棄式環槽刀片20與刀槽座11緊密接觸,同時該捨棄式環槽刀片20受到螺絲頭31之推頂時,在該刀桿10之軸向與該刀槽座11緊密地接觸,據此,該捨棄式環槽刀片20與刀槽座11在3個軸向完全受到限制與固定。 Referring to Figures 1, 4, and 5, the disposable ring groove insert 20 of the present invention is placed. When the screw 30 is screwed into the screw hole 12 in the slot seat 11 at the end of the arbor 10, the screw head 31 pushes the oblique pushing surface 242 of the retractable ring groove blade 20, and the screw head 31 and the oblique push The contact point of the face 242 analyzes the thrust of the disposable ring groove blade 20 in the downward (-Z), right (X) and front (Y) directions, and the downward (-Z) thrust causes the disposable ring groove blade 20 is in close contact with the bottom surface of the sipe holder 11, and the thrust toward the right (X) causes the positioning pin 23 of the disposable ring groove blade 20 to be in close contact with the circular arc hole 111 of the sipe holder 11, and the forward direction ( The thrust of Y) causes the disposable ring groove insert 20 to be in close contact with the knife seat 11 while the disposable ring groove insert 20 is pushed by the screw head 31 in the axial direction of the cutter bar 10 and the cutter seat 11 is in close contact with each other, whereby the discarding ring groove insert 20 and the slotted seat 11 are completely restricted and fixed in three axial directions.
請參閱第6圖所示,該捨棄式環槽刀片20銑削時,承受銑削 力時,該捨棄式環槽刀片20承受朝下之壓力,朝下之壓力受到刀槽座11底面之支撐,該螺絲30未受到任何應力,故該捨棄式環槽刀片20之定位非常穩固。 Referring to Figure 6, the disposable ring groove insert 20 is subjected to milling when milling. When the force is applied, the disposable ring groove blade 20 receives the downward pressure, and the downward pressure is supported by the bottom surface of the knife seat 11. The screw 30 is not subjected to any stress, so the positioning of the disposable ring groove blade 20 is very stable.
請參閱第7圖所示,該捨棄式環槽刀片20之刀刃22設有斷屑 槽221,當該刀刃22銑削時,刀刃22承受朝下及朝右之分力,朝下之推力由刀槽座11之底面承受,而該朝右之推力藉由該刀槽座11之圓弧孔111承受,故該捨棄式環槽刀片20之定位非常穩固。 Referring to FIG. 7, the blade 22 of the disposable ring groove blade 20 is provided with chip breaking. The groove 221, when the cutting edge 22 is milled, the cutting edge 22 receives the downward and rightward component forces, and the downward thrust is received by the bottom surface of the sipe holder 11, and the rightward thrust is achieved by the shank seat 11 The arc hole 111 is received, so the positioning of the disposable ring groove blade 20 is very stable.
前述之實施例係為單一刀刃22,係應用於尺寸較小之環槽銑 削,請參閱第8~11圖所示,係為本發明多刀刃之實施例,該捨棄式環槽銑刀,包含一刀桿10,該刀桿10末端設有一刀盤13,該刀盤13之周緣布設有 一個以上之刀槽座11,該刀槽座11得供一捨棄式槽刀片20容置入,該刀槽座11之一隅設一呈半圓形狀之圓弧孔111,該圓弧孔111之一側設一螺孔12,該螺孔12其供螺絲頭31容置之錐形孔121係與該圓弧孔111之部位相互過切;請參閱第8、9圖所示,係為3個刀槽座11之實施例以及第10、11圖所示,係為8個刀槽座11之實施例,本發明得以應用於尺寸較大之內或外環槽銑削。 The foregoing embodiment is a single blade 22, which is applied to a ring milling with a small size. For the cutting, as shown in FIGS. 8-11, the embodiment of the multi-blade cutting blade of the present invention comprises a cutter bar 10, and a cutter head 13 is disposed at the end of the cutter bar 10, and the cutter head 13 is provided. The circumference of the cloth More than one sipe holder 11 is provided for a discarding slot blade 20, and one of the slot holders 11 is provided with a semicircular arc hole 111, one of the arc holes 111 A screw hole 12 is disposed on the side of the screw hole 12, and the tapered hole 121 for receiving the screw head 31 is cut away from the arc hole 111; for example, as shown in FIGS. The embodiment of the sipe holder 11 and the embodiment shown in Figs. 10 and 11 are eight sipe seats 11, and the present invention can be applied to a larger-sized inner or outer ring groove milling.
請參閱第12圖所示,本發明應用於內螺紋銑削之實施例,該 捨棄式環槽刀片20設有適當長度之牙刀刃221,該牙刀刃221之長度得搭配螺孔長度,該牙刀刃221之捨棄式環槽刀片20得以一次完成內螺紋之銑削,改善傳統單一牙刀刃之捨棄式刀片必須繞完整個螺紋長度才能完成銑削加工,據此得以減短加工之時間。 Referring to FIG. 12, the present invention is applied to an embodiment of internal thread milling, which The discarding ring groove cutter 20 is provided with a tooth blade 221 of a proper length. The length of the tooth blade 221 is matched with the length of the screw hole. The discarded ring groove blade 20 of the tooth blade 221 can complete the internal thread milling at one time to improve the traditional single tooth. The cutting edge of the blade must be wound around the entire thread length to complete the milling process, thereby reducing the processing time.
請參閱第13、14圖所示,係本發明刀刃22尺寸增大之實施 例,由於該刀刃22尺寸增大,且切削時將會承受較大之切削應力,故該捨棄式環槽刀片20必須增加鎖固之結構,於該捨棄式環槽刀片20適當間距之垂直方向且位於該定位栓23之一側設一讓槽243,該讓槽243之末端設一斜推面244,因此該讓槽243與推面244係位於該捨棄式環槽刀片20之垂直方向;此外該刀桿10相對於讓槽243位置設有一螺孔14,該螺孔14其供螺絲頭31容置之錐形孔141係與該圓弧孔111之部位相互重疊過切;據此該捨棄式環槽刀片20在其長度之適當位置得藉由螺絲30鎖固,使得該捨棄式環槽刀片20得以穩固地被鎖固,提升銑刀之剛性,避免銑削時產生震動現象,使銑削作業更加順暢。 Please refer to Figures 13 and 14 for the implementation of the increased size of the blade 22 of the present invention. For example, since the size of the cutting edge 22 is increased and a large cutting stress is to be applied during cutting, the discarding ring groove insert 20 must have a locking structure in the vertical direction of the appropriate spacing of the disposable ring grooved inserts 20. A slot 243 is disposed on one side of the positioning pin 23, and a slot 244 is disposed at an end of the slot 243. Therefore, the slot 243 and the pushing surface 244 are located in a vertical direction of the disc ring insert 20; In addition, the shank 10 is provided with a screw hole 14 at a position corresponding to the groove 243, and the screw hole 14 is provided with a tapered hole 141 for receiving the screw head 31 and a portion of the circular hole 111 overlapping with each other; The retractable annular grooved blade 20 is locked by a screw 30 at a proper position of the length thereof, so that the disposable annular grooved blade 20 can be firmly locked, the rigidity of the milling cutter is increased, and vibration is generated during milling, so that milling is performed. The job is smoother.
本發明之捨棄式環槽銑刀,除應用於銑削內槽孔或是內螺紋 之銑削外,應得以應用於各式之倒角作業,亦得以應用於車床之內槽、內螺紋或是各式倒角之作業。 The disposable ring groove cutter of the present invention is used for milling internal slots or internal threads In addition to milling, it should be applied to all kinds of chamfering operations, and can also be applied to the inner groove of the lathe, internal thread or various chamfering operations.
綜上所述,本發明捨棄式結構設計之環槽刀片,其體積小,不論銑削大小不同尺寸之內、外環槽,其體積大小幾近相同,僅為刀刃之尺寸變化,故改變習用捨棄式環槽刀片之設計,尺寸越大體積相對越大,而且整個鎢鋼製造之本體,尤其是非刀刃之部位,佔用捨棄式環槽刀片大部分之體積,相對浪費過多之材料於非刀刃之部位,因此造成該捨棄式環槽銑刀價格高昂及經濟效益差等缺點,故本發明完全改變習用之設計範疇,此一結構設計乃為刀具業界之首創,深具新穎性及創新性。 In summary, the ring groove insert of the discarding structure design of the present invention has a small volume, and the inner and outer ring grooves of different sizes of the milling size are almost the same in size, and only the size of the blade changes, so the change is discarded. The design of the ring groove blade is larger and the volume is relatively larger, and the whole body made of tungsten steel, especially the non-blade part, takes up most of the volume of the discarded ring groove blade, and relatively wastes too much material on the non-blade part. Therefore, the disposable ring groove milling cutter has the disadvantages of high price and poor economic efficiency. Therefore, the invention completely changes the design scope of the conventional use. This structural design is the first in the cutting tool industry, and is novel and innovative.
